简体中文简体中文
EnglishEnglish
简体中文简体中文

小程序源码开发:揭秘如何从零开始打造爆款小程序

2024-12-27 01:31:21

随着移动互联网的快速发展,小程序作为一种轻量级的应用程序,凭借其便捷性、易用性和低门槛的优势,迅速成为了开发者和企业争相开发的热门项目。而小程序源码开发作为实现这一目标的关键步骤,其重要性不言而喻。本文将深入探讨小程序源码开发的全过程,帮助读者了解如何从零开始打造爆款小程序。

一、小程序源码开发概述

1.小程序源码开发的概念

小程序源码开发指的是从零开始,利用编程语言和技术框架,将一个创意或需求转化为实际可运行的小程序。它包括前端和后端两部分,前端负责用户界面的展示和交互,后端负责数据的处理和存储。

2.小程序源码开发的优势

(1)门槛低:相比传统APP开发,小程序源码开发对技术要求较低,易于上手。

(2)成本较低:小程序开发周期短,成本相对较低。

(3)用户体验好:小程序体积小,加载速度快,用户体验更佳。

(4)传播速度快:小程序易于分享和传播,有助于快速提高用户量。

二、小程序源码开发流程

1.需求分析

在开始小程序源码开发之前,首先要明确开发目标,进行需求分析。主要包括以下几个方面:

(1)目标用户:了解用户需求,确定小程序的定位。

(2)功能需求:明确小程序需要实现的功能。

(3)界面设计:设计简洁、美观、易用的小程序界面。

2.技术选型

根据需求分析,选择合适的技术框架和开发工具。目前,常见的小程序开发框架有微信小程序、支付宝小程序、百度小程序等。以下是几种常见框架的优缺点:

(1)微信小程序:用户基数大,生态完善,但开发难度相对较高。

(2)支付宝小程序:支付场景丰富,但用户基数相对较小。

(3)百度小程序:搜索场景丰富,但用户基数相对较小。

3.前端开发

前端开发主要包括以下内容:

(1)页面布局:使用HTML、CSS等技术实现页面布局。

(2)交互设计:使用JavaScript等技术实现用户交互。

(3)组件开发:封装常用组件,提高开发效率。

4.后端开发

后端开发主要包括以下内容:

(1)数据库设计:设计数据库结构,实现数据存储。

(2)接口开发:编写接口,实现前后端数据交互。

(3)服务器部署:将小程序部署到服务器,实现线上运行。

5.测试与优化

在开发过程中,要不断进行测试,确保小程序功能完善、性能稳定。主要包括以下几个方面:

(1)功能测试:测试小程序各个功能是否正常。

(2)性能测试:测试小程序的加载速度、响应速度等性能指标。

(3)兼容性测试:测试小程序在不同设备、不同浏览器上的兼容性。

6.上线与推广

完成开发后,将小程序提交至各大平台进行审核,审核通过后即可上线。上线后,要通过各种渠道进行推广,提高用户量。

三、总结

小程序源码开发是一个系统性的工程,涉及多个环节。通过本文的介绍,相信读者对小程序源码开发有了更深入的了解。要想打造爆款小程序,关键在于深入了解用户需求,选择合适的技术框架,注重用户体验,并不断优化产品。只要用心去做,相信每个人都能开发出属于自己的爆款小程序。